PC HELP, USB 2? motherboard drivers???
just got a camcorder that needs usb 2 to conect to the pc
my motherboard has 6 usb 2 ports, but if i plug in the cam or anything, it says, " this device can work faster if you conect it to a usb 2 port, click here to see available ports" when i do theres 6! tryed all 6 on the motherboard, but still the same?
been to asus web and downloaded all the drivers for the mb A7V8X-X but theres no mention on there of usb 2 drivers, so how do i make the usb 2 work?????

Fil,
updating the chipset drivers might help (includes USB), asus current version is here (4.43):
ftp://dlsvr02.asus.com/pub/ASUS/misc/utils/4in1_443.zip
Usually the ones from VIA themselves works better and are newer (5.09):
http://www.viaarena.com/Driver/VIA_H...nPro_V509A.zip
Install the VIA ones and you might see a difference. If not, use a newer
USB Hub (Voltage might be low of the ports), that might resolve 1.0/2.0 USB issues.
